-1

我正在尝试找到一种方法来使用 GmailAPI 阅读 Google 私人群组的收件箱电子邮件。我考虑过使用一个服务帐户,该帐户将成为该组的成员,并且只有读取权限。你知道我该怎么做吗?

谢谢,

4

1 回答 1

0

您需要从 gsuite 域设置域范围的委派,以便将服务帐户与 gmail 一起使用。

  • 打开服务帐户页面。如果出现提示,请选择一个项目。
  • 单击添加创建服务帐户,输入服务帐户的名称和描述。您可以使用默认服务帐号 ID,也可以选择其他唯一的 ID。完成后单击创建。
  • 后面的服务帐户权限(可选)部分不是必需的。- 单击继续。在授予用户对此服务帐户的访问权限屏幕上,向下滚动到 - 创建密钥部分。单击添加创建密钥。
  • 在出现的侧面板中,为您的密钥选择格式:推荐使用 JSON。
  • 单击创建。您的新公钥/私钥对已生成并下载到您的机器;它是该密钥的唯一副本。有关如何安全存储它的信息,请参阅管理服务帐户密钥。
  • 在保存到您的计算机的私钥对话框上单击关闭,然后单击完成以返回到您的服务帐户表。

执行 Google Workspace 域范围的授权

于 2021-01-26T14:40:23.013 回答